Unhealthy Foods: Explanation and Risks

Unhealthy foods refer to food items that contain high amounts of sugar, salt, unhealthy fats, and additives. These foods provide little nutritional value and are often referred to as "junk" foods. Examples of unhealthy foods include fast food, processed snacks, sugary drinks, and highfat desserts.

Consuming unhealthy foods on a regular basis can have several negative effects on the body. Firstly, these foods can lead to weight gain due to their high calorie content. This, in turn, can increase the risk of developing health conditions such as heart disease, diabetes, and high blood pressure.

Secondly, unhealthy foods often contain high amounts of saturated and trans fats, which can raise cholesterol levels and lead to clogged arteries, ultimately increasing the risk of heart disease and stroke.

Thirdly, consuming too much sugar can lead to a variety of health problems, including obesity, poor dental health, and an increased risk of diabetes.

Lastly, processed foods often contain additives such as preservatives and artificial colors and flavors. These additives have been linked to a number of health concerns, including hyperactivity in children and an increased risk of cancer.

To mitigate the risks associated with unhealthy foods, it is important to limit their consumption and opt for healthier alternatives. This includes consuming a diet rich in whole foods, fruits and vegetables, lean proteins, and healthy fats.

In addition, engaging in regular physical activity can help offset the negative effects of unhealthy food consumption. By maintaining a healthy diet and lifestyle, individuals can reduce their risk of developing chronic diseases and improve their overall health and wellbeing.

In conclusion, unhealthy foods provide little nutritional value and can have several negative effects on the body, including weight gain, heart disease, and diabetes. By limiting consumption of these foods and opting for healthier alternatives, individuals can improve their overall health and wellbeing.
